Partnerships
Wunder's collaborations with financial institutions and investors are crucial. They include Ares Management, Cyrus Capital Partners, and Blackstone Credit. These partnerships enable Wunder to secure funding for solar projects. In 2024, the solar industry saw significant investment, with over $20 billion in new projects.
Wunder's success hinges on partnerships with solar installers and developers across the U.S. These partners handle the crucial on-site installation of solar panels. In 2024, the U.S. solar market saw over 32 gigawatts of new capacity added, demonstrating the scale of opportunities. These collaborations are vital for Wunder's project deployment.
Wunder collaborates with real estate firms and property owners, securing locations for solar installations. These partnerships are crucial for accessing rooftops, land, and parking areas. In 2024, the commercial real estate market saw significant interest in sustainability projects. The U.S. solar market installed 32.4 GW of new capacity in 2023, and this trend continues. This collaboration fuels Wunder's ability to deploy solar energy solutions.

Activities
Wunder's key activity centers on developing and financing solar projects for commercial and industrial clients. This includes site evaluation, system design, and securing project funding. In 2024, the U.S. solar market saw over $33 billion in investments. Managing projects through their lifecycle is another key function.
Wunder's core revolves around its proprietary technology platform. This platform streamlines project evaluation, financing, and management. It's critical for their operations, ensuring efficiency. As of late 2024, the platform handled over $5 billion in project financing.
Sales and business development at Wunder involve actively engaging with potential clients, educating them about solar solutions, and securing deals. This includes building strong relationships and thoroughly understanding the specific needs of businesses, municipalities, and real estate firms. In 2024, the solar industry saw a 20% increase in commercial installations. Wunder focuses on a consultative sales approach. This has resulted in a 15% higher customer retention rate compared to industry average.

Energy Asset Management
Wunder's energy asset management focuses on the continuous oversight of solar systems. They provide services like system monitoring, maintenance, and performance reporting. This ensures their solar installations consistently perform at their best, maximizing energy output and client satisfaction. The goal is to optimize the lifecycle of each solar project.
- 2024 saw a 15% increase in solar asset management contracts.
- Maintenance costs typically account for 1-3% of initial project costs annually.
- Performance reporting helps identify and address a 10% average efficiency loss.
- Clients report a 95% satisfaction rate with Wunder's asset management services.

Value Propositions
Wunder simplifies solar energy access for various entities. They streamline project development, easing the process for businesses and organizations. This approach helps to reduce the barriers to entry in the solar market. In 2024, the commercial solar sector saw a 15% increase in installations.
Wunder's value lies in financial benefits, helping clients save money with clean on-site power. Offering 'no-CapEx' solutions, Wunder makes solar financially accessible. In 2024, the average cost of solar panels decreased, making it even more attractive. This approach enables immediate cost savings.
Wunder enables businesses to achieve ESG goals by providing renewable energy solutions. This helps them meet sustainability targets while generating financial returns. In 2024, the ESG investment market reached over $40 trillion globally. Wunder's approach aligns environmental responsibility with profitability. This creates value for investors and the planet.
